What should I look for in a Spanish-speaking daycare near me in Phoenix, AZ?
When searching for a Spanish-speaking daycare near you in Phoenix, AZ, parents should take into account not only the language and bilingual capabilities of the teachers, staff, and caregivers but also the overall educational program. Look for a Spanish-speaking daycare that offers age-appropriate structure with academic goals intended to help children build their Spanish language skills alongside traditional learning activities like reading, writing, math, science, and art.

What are the benefits of Spanish-speaking daycare near me in Phoenix, AZ?
Spanish-speaking daycares near you in Phoenix, AZ can provide a wide range of benefits for kids. Immersion in Spanish from a young age helps to increase Spanish language fluency and proficiency and fosters an understanding of Spanish culture and customs. Spanish-speaking daycares often help foster bilingualism, which can provide long-term cognitive, academic, and educational benefits for children. Additionally, Spanish-speaking daycare teaches essential social skills such as sharing with peers and developing communication methods in Spanish. Thus, Spanish-speaking daycare contributes to the growth and development of children in many important ways.
How can I find a good Spanish-speaking daycare near me in Phoenix, AZ?
Spanish-speaking daycares can be a wonderful option for Spanish-speaking parents and families who want their children to be immersed in Spanish while they learn and grow. When researching Spanish-speaking daycares, be sure to look closely at their quality assurance standards and policies, their training practices, the types of activities they maintain, and the Spanish proficiency of their staff. It is important that Spanish-speaking daycare centers are staffed by qualified educators who maintain Spanish fluency throughout the day. Additionally, make certain that Spanish is used in a wide variety of age-appropriate and playful activities to ensure maximum language acquisition for all students.
